Farmers begin rail roko in Amritsar

DEVIDASPURA (AMRITSAR): To push for their demands, including complete waiver of loans of farmers and labourers, Kisan Mazdoor Sangharsh Committee (KMSC) activists disrupted rail traffic by staging a sit-in on the Amritsar-Delhi railway track at Devidaspura, near Amritsar on Monday.

Apart from women and children from farming families, a group of agitating ‘corona warriors’ and other class IV employees have joined the stir to build pressure on the state government.

Stating that the ‘rail roko morcha’ would continue till the next announcement, KMSC general secretary Sarwan Singh Pandher said they were in for the long haul.

While addressing the farmers, KMSC state president Satnam Singh Pannun said the Punjab government had assured to resolve all the issues of farmers and labourers during a meeting held with a group of ministers on September 29. “But the government didn’t fulfil its promises which forced us to sit on the railway track,” he added.

Another leader Gurbachan Singh Chabba said if the government didn’t accept their demands then the morcha would be extended and laid on three more places from Wednesday.
